Strategic Placement and Visual Hierarchy

Understanding where to place these design assets is crucial for maintaining a strong visual hierarchy. In my review, I found that Watercolor Christmas Decor Sublimation shines in large layout areas where the details of the brushstrokes can be appreciated. They are perfect for hero graphics on landing pages, full-width banners for web design, and featured images in editorial design such as holiday lookbooks or blog headers. The emotional appeal of the watercolor style helps establish an immediate connection with the audience, fostering a sense of trust and warmth that is essential for small business branding.

However, a professional designer must also recognize the limitations. These assets should be used carefully in contexts requiring extreme precision or minimalism. For instance, using them in logo design can be risky if the logo needs to scale down significantly for favicons or embroidery. The fine details of the watercolor bleed might disappear at small sizes, leading to a muddy appearance. Similarly, in crowded layouts or low-contrast designs, the soft edges can get lost against complex backgrounds. It is generally advisable to avoid using these Illustrations for strict corporate materials where a clean, sharp visual hierarchy is paramount. They are best reserved for projects that benefit from a softer, more approachable tone.

Technical Considerations for Commercial Use

Before integrating any digital product into a client deliverable, rigorous testing is non-negotiable. With Watercolor Christmas Decor Sublimation, I recommend several practical checks. First, always test the asset in black and white to ensure the tonal range holds up without color. This is vital for newspaper ads or monochrome merchandise. Second, check contrast on both light and dark backgrounds; while PNG transparency is usually included, the semi-transparent nature of watercolor can sometimes create unintended color shifts when placed over dark hues.

For those utilizing cutting machines, verifying the file formats is essential. If the bundle includes SVG design files, inspect the vector editability to ensure paths are clean and suitable for Cricut projects or vinyl cutting. For sublimation, confirm the DPI of the PNG design files to guarantee crisp print quality on textiles and hard substrates. It is also wise to compare these watercolor elements with your chosen typography. They pair exceptionally well with script font and handwritten font styles, reinforcing the handmade aesthetic, but can also provide a lovely contrast to bold sans serif font choices for a modern twist.
